NER (Normalized Effective Rank) quantifies dimensional utilization across layers using entropy analysis of singular value distributions. NER calculation involves Singular Value Decomposition (SVD) of weight matrix A. Singular values form a probability distribution through normalization. Entropy H of this distribution yields the Effective Rank (ERank) as 2^H. Normalizing by maximum possible entropy H_max produces a value between 0 and 1, measuring dimensional utilization efficiency.

Run the script with:
    python mastermerge.py --config mastermerge_config.yaml (optional)

The script loads configuration, processes each model by downloading, loading weights, normalizing layers, calculating NER for each layer, using NER to identify the optimal layer, finally creating a composite model with the highest ner in each layer.

def calculate_normalized_effective_rank(A: torch.Tensor) -> float:
    """ "Calculate the Normalized Effective Rank (NER) of a matrix."""
    try:
        # get the singular values
        if A.dtype != torch.float32:
            A = A.float()
        if A.dim() == 1:
            A = A.unsqueeze(0)
        if 1 in A.shape:
            S = A.abs().view(-1)
        else:
            S = torch.linalg.svdvals(A)
        S = S[S > 1e-12]
        if S.numel() == 0:
            return 0.0

        # normalize the singular values
        S_sum = S.sum()
        S /= S_sum

        # calculate and return normalized effective rank
        log_S = torch.log2(S)
        H = -torch.dot(S, log_S)
        H_max = torch.log2(
            torch.tensor(float(S.numel()), dtype=torch.float32, device=S.device)
        )
        return (H / H_max).item() if H_max > 0 else 0.0
    except Exception as e:
        print(f"Error calculating NER: {e}")
        return 0.0
